A Decade Ago, I Quit Radio, For Candy!

On Halloween 2003, ten years ago tonight, I quit radio.  

Spoiler alert; That didn't go too well, considering what I do for a living today!


Back then, I was a part of a very popular morning show with an amazing team of talented people. Who I won't mention their names, to protect my secret admiration to them all...


...at the time, I was working for a company that wanted to take ownership & control the morning show website, which I designed, managed and also co-owned with a friend.  They wanted to put ads on this site, even though they had nothing to do with it.


We started this website at another radio station, and while there, it drew more traffic than their own main website.  The station liked our promotional abilities, so they actually shutdown their website and redirected web traffic to our site.  Beyond asking me to build some personality pages for the rest of the on-air talent, the station never interfered with what we were doing.

As they said;
 "Why mess with what is already working!"
When we got to this new station, after a short while, they wanted to insert their sponsor's advertisement banners or gain full access to the site.  I was not in favor of this, so a disagreement began.

On Halloween evening, back in 2003, my boss contacted me and told me that he wanted me to immediately transfer files of our site to their server.  I started to do it, which was no small task and this was outside of my regular working hours.

While doing this, I got a message from my sister, telling me that my two young nieces we 're waiting for me to go out Trick-or-Treating.  That is when I made the decision that I was not going to miss my time with my girls, who were just visiting from Wisconsin.

So, I quit my job and went out looking for candy with a 7 year and 4 year old nieces.

I had no regrets and kept myself busy by working in television.


I did not return to the radio studio until about a couple years later, when I came back to help my old morning team with a project.  After that, I was asked to come back, and with new management, I was happy to rejoin them.
